ADMISSION TO THE SIXTH FORM
Admission to the Sixth Form is by written examination and interview in the Autumn Term prior to the proposed year of entry. All candidates will take entrance papers in the subjects they propose to study at 'AS' level. Each paper lasts 30 minutes. We anticipate that the majority of girls will study four subjects. In addition, all candidates will sit a cognitive assessment, for which no preparation is necessary.
Approximately 95% of total GCSE entries at CLSG are awarded A* and A grades. In this context, we would expect all our students to achieve 9 or 10 GCSEs at A* and A. We recognise that girls might be unlucky and achieve a B grade, but we would not expect any girls entering the Sixth Form to have more than 2 B grades at GCSE. Girls need to achieve at least an A grade at GCSE in the subjects that they wish to follow for A Level. At the end of the Lower Sixth, girls are expected to achieve a minimum of a B grade in any AS subject which she wishes to continue with at A2.
The completed registration form for Sixth Form entry must reach the Admissions Officer normally by a specific date in October (see below for 2014 entry) before the year of entry. Following the written papers a short-list of candidates will be called for interview, and from these the final selection will be made.
